Dr. Fuensanta Botello's Volunteer Efforts Benefit Patients and the Community

Jan 11, 2008

Fuensanta Botello, MD

Dr. Fuensanta Botello draws upon her unique life story to help patients in her psychiatric practice at the Richmond facility and in her volunteer work. Having come to this country from Franco’s Spain, she uses her own experience as an immigrant to relate to her patients, many of whom are new to the United States. A mother who had a second child while she was in medical school, Dr. Botello has worked tirelessly over the years to improve health care for women in the community, successfully organizing a clinic and volunteering in it to provide medical care. Deeply respected for her work supporting colleagues under stress, she contributes actively to the Physician Wellness program and volunteers for the California Medical Association. As a leader of the Richmond Ethics Committee, she serves as a mediator for patients and physicians alike. Her colleagues especially admire her for successfully empowering others.
